Water Damage Cleanup Questions
What causes water damage in homes? Water damage can result from plumbing leaks, roof leaks, or flooding, leading to moisture intrusion in walls, floors, and ceilings.
How can water damage affect a property? It can cause structural issues, promote mold growth, and damage personal belongings if not addressed promptly.
What are common signs of water damage? Signs include discoloration, warping, musty odors, and visible water stains on walls or ceilings.
What should homeowners do after water intrusion? Remove standing water if possible, ventilate the area, and contact a professional for cleanup and drying services.
